Fact meme?

The term “fact meme” is most typically used to refer to a meme that contains reliable information that can be verified. These memes are often used to spread awareness about important issues or to correct misinformation that is circulating online. While some fact memes may be purely factual, others may also contain elements of humor or satire.

Did you know water?

Water is definitely one of the most important substances on Earth. Not only does it regulate the planet’s temperature, but it also helps to keep our own bodies temperature regulated. Additionally, water carries nutrients and oxygen to cells, cushions our joints, protects our organs and tissues, and removes wastes.
